Leeks with Three Mustard and Cheese Sauce

3lb leeks- cut in half

2oz butter

3oz plain flour

3/4 pint milk

6oz grated cheddar cheese

1oz grated parmesan

2tbs breadcrumbs and 1oz grated cheddar for topping

1tbs wholegrain mustard

1tbs Dijon mustard

1st English mustard

salt and pepper

  • Preheat oven to gas mark 6 or 200C
  • Put leeks in a pan of cold salted water, bring to the boil and simmer for 3 mins or until tender
  • Drain and place under cold water immediately to stop the cooking process
  • Bring butter, flour and milk up to the boil, whisk continuously- once it is up to the boil, reduce heat and simmer for 2 mins
  • Add the cheese and mustard and season to taste
  • Put leeks in a shallow dish and pour the sauce over
  • Mix the breadcrumbs and cheese together and sprinkle on top of the leeks
  • Bake for 20 minutes until top is golden brown
